CMIPS benchmarks and costs updated with Azure

After testing Microsoft Azure Small (A1), Large (A3), Extra Large (A4) and A7, this is how the results are.

(More CMIPS means more perfomance so a most powerful instance).

As you can see Azure Extra Large and Azure A7 have the same CMIPS performance, the main difference is in the number of RAM.

About Linux prices we can say that Azure are not the cheapest, but they try to be much cheaper than Amazon. They have a long path to provide so many and so quality products as Amazon, but they are working intensely.

As we are commited to Start ups and Open Source we didn’t compare prices for Windows Servers between Amazon and Microsoft Azure.

In the next graphic you can see the CMIPS (CPU power + memory speed), blue bar -longer bar means more power-, and the CUP (Cost of Unit of Process) multiplied to 10M to fit the graphic scale, orange bar -shorter bar means cheap price, longer bar means expensive price per CMIP.

The best power-price are up on the list (long blue bar) but have a small orange bar.

Linode has an amazing relationg between power and price, the physical dedicated server from OVH introduced to have a wider picture has also a very good CUP ratio and with high computing power Digital Ocean (they equip SSD disks) beats the game with very powerful instances yet not so expensive as Amazon.
